Borgward can be an automobile manufacturer originally created by Carl F. W. Borgward. The original company, based in Bremen with Germany, ceased operations in the actual 1960s. The Borgward group developed four brands of vehicles: Borgward, Hansa, Goliath and Lloyd.The marque has due to the fact been revived by Carl Borgward's son, Christian Borgward, together with his associate Karlheinz L. Knöss, with assistance from Chinese language investment, and unveiled the company's first new car inside over 40 years, the BX7 at this 2015 International Motor Display.The origins of Bremen's most significant auto-business get back on 1905 with the organization in nearby Varel with the "Hansa Automobilgesellschaft" and the muse in Bremen itself connected with "Namag", maker of the Lloyd car or truck. These two businesses merged in 1914 to make the "Hansa-Lloyd-Werke A. G. ". After the war, in the troubled economy then confronting Germany, the business failed to prosper and with the late 1920s faced a bankruptcy proceeding. For Carl Borgward, already the successful creator on the Goliath-Blitzkarren business, the misfortunes of Hansa-Lloyd presented a possibility greatly to expand this scope of his auto business, and he took control from it.

The 1st "automobile" Carl Borgward developed was the 1924 Blitzkarren (lightning cart), a sort of tiny three-wheeled van with only two hp (1. 5 kW), which was an enormous success on the market gap it filled. Traders with a small budget purchased for delivery. The Reichspost ordered many for postal service.In 1929, Borgward became the representative of Hansa Lloyd AG having gotten to merge his "Goliath-Werke Borgward & Company. " with "Hansa-Lloyd. The small Goliath-Blitzkarren had right now evolved into the however three wheeler timber framed synthetic leather bodied 5 or even 7 hp Goliath Leader. Borgward turned his attention to the other businesses as well as led the development from the Hansa Konsul. In February 1937, there came the new Hansa Borgward 2000 in addition to in 1939 the name was shortened to Borgward 2000. The 2000 model was followed by the Borgward 2300that remained in production until 1942.After World War II, in 1946 Carl Borgward used a few of the brand names from organizations he had acquired over time to found three different companies: Borgward, Goliath and Lloyd. This was intended to increase the quality of steel allocated to his business during a period of austerity and rationing. For many purposes the lenders would be run being a single entity, but in a business operated by a man to whom delegation didn't come naturally the spreading of legal entities however added unhelpful layers of complexity throughout the 1950s and encouraged a broadening on the range which ultimately proved financially unsustainable with all the sales volumes achievable. In 1949 company presented the Borgward Hansa 1500.On the list of top engineers at Borgward by 1938-1952 was Dipl. Ing. Hubert M. Meingast.Production of the Borgward Isabella began in 1954. The Isabella would become Borgward's most popular model and remained in production for the life of the company. In 1960 the Borgward P100 seemed to be introduced, equipped with pneumatic suspension.Borgward introduced a brand of 1500 cc sports racers inside late 1950s, with the 16-valve engine from these to become successful Formula Two power unit (which was also used by many F1 privateers in 1961).Although Borgward pioneered technical novelties within the German market such since air suspension and intelligent transmission, the company had trouble competing in the market. While larger companies including Opel and VW took benefit from economies of scale along with kept their prices low to realize market share, Borgward's cost structure was even above necessary for its measurement, as it basically run as four tiny independent companies and not implemented such basic price tag reduction strategies as mutual development and parts sharing involving the company's makes. Borgward suffered quality problems also. The Lloyd Arabella was technically advanced like a water-cooled boxer with entry wheel drive, but plagued with problems including water leakage and gearbox errors. Lloyd lost money on the car even though it was more expensive in comparison with its direct competitors.In 1961, the company was pressured into liquidation by collectors. Carl Borgward died inside July 1963, still insisting the company have been technically solvent. This proved to be true inside sense that after your creditors were paid fully, there was still some. 5 million Marks left from the business.

Accounts of difficulties at Borgward surfaced in the article that appeared inside Germany's leading news mag, “Der Spiegel” on 15 December 1960”. The very long, detailed, and in places repeating Spiegel article was highlighted with a picture of Borgward, cigar in mouth, on the magazine’s entrance cover. It was strongly important of Carl Borgward's organization approach, and included many with the arguments later advanced to describe or justify the corporation's demise. The widest range connected with cars from any maker in Germany, produced by three until recently operationally autonomous businesses (Borgward, Goliath and Lloyd) has been supporting a turnover involving only 650 million Signifies, placing the overall sales value on the combined Borgward auto businesses only in fifth situation among Germany's auto-makers. The 70-year-old Carl Borgward's "hands-on" insistence by using an increasingly manic proliferation connected with new and modified models featuring adventurous, but under-developed technological innovations ("fast manisch[e] Konstruierwut") presented rise to components which many times did not work, broke down or fell into apart, resulting in massive expenses for pre-delivery remediation and/or submit delivery warranty work that found their long ago to the company.The December 1960 Spiegel article wasn't the only serious general public criticism targeting Borgward presently: suddenly stridently negative (if more succinct) comments also turned up in the influential mass-market Bild newspaper and in television stories. Critical media commentaries additionally appeared concerning large loans towards the Borgward Group provided from the local Landesbank.It is apparent which the business was confronting cash-flow difficulties towards the end of 1960. Capital intensive businesses such as auto manufacturing use his or her expensive machines and tools most efficiently if they use them constantly at full capacity, but the car market in Europe inside the 1950s/60s was more periodic than today, with sales diminishing within Winter, then peaking in the first summer months: Borgward’s inventory of unsold cars at the conclusion of 1960 was beyond usual, reflecting ambitious growth plans, most obviously in respect of the united states market[11] The December 1960 Spiegel article speculated that in the 15, 000 Borgward cars ordered through the North American dealers in 1960 (and on the 12, 000 delivered to these individuals) 6, 000 might have to be taken back following a slump in North american demand. (Borgward was not the one European auto maker hit by the North American slump widely used for imported cars through 1960. In the same season two ships carrying Renault Dauphines were turned back mid-Atlantic because the docks in Ny were overcrowded with unsold Dauphines.

By the end of December 1960 Borgward approached the lending company for a further just one million Marks of credit, the loan to be backed by the guarantee from the Bremen regional government which initially the Bremen senators consented to provide. However, following the flood regarding critical press comment the senators withdrew their guarantee. They now required Carl Borgward to pledge the business itself to the state in return for the guarantee. After a tense 13-hour meeting widely reported within a still hostile media, Borgward agreed to the particular senate’s terms on four February 1961, thereby averting the bankruptcy of the business.The Bremen Senate furthermore insisted on appointing a nominee as chairman on the company’s supervisory board. The man they decided to go with was Johannes Semler with whom reports generally describe being a “Wirtschaftsprüfer” (public auditor), though this designation, especially once translated directly into English, does less than full justice for the breadth of Semler’s occupation. He had studied regulation at university and worked initially as being a lawyer. The scion of a top Hamburg political family, in 1945 he received himself been a founding person in the centre-right CSU celebration, and was a member of the Bundestag between 1950 as well as 1953. Despite his Hamburg beginnings, Semler was by this time around based in Munich, with a network of contacts inside Bavarian establishment that likely included fellow CSU politician plus the future German chancellor, Ludwig Erhard, who in 1948 had succeeded Semler inside a top administrative position in the Bizone. The appointment of Johannes Semler as the representative of the Bremen senators to be able to chair the Borgward supervisory mother board would, in retrospect, contribute to the debate that followed the Borgward individual bankruptcy.

With 28 July 1961 Semler, as Chairman of the supervisory board joined the directors with the three companies Borgward, Goliath and Lloyd to instigate proceedings to the establishment of a “Vergleichsverfahren”, which would have provided for just a court sanctioned scheme of arrangement enabling the organization to continue to trade while at the same time protecting the interests associated with creditors. [16] Two months later on, however, in September 1961, the Borgward and Goliath companies were declared bankrupt, followed in November through the Lloyd business. Subsequent “conspiracy theorists” have got suggested that Semler, for reasons of his own, never had any objective of allowing the Borgward auto-businesses for you to survive.
